Preparation for College Royal is the theme for this special issue of The Review. Numerous articles provide instruction on the preparation of animals, plants, and domestic science exhibits, including an article on the art of designing an exhibit. Agricultural articles pertain to the science in agricultural policy, that British brewers use O. A. C. Barley and improvements in the poultry industry. The English Department provides advice of preparing for a debating contest and the etymology of the word "hobo". Campus news reports on the success of the 1932 Conversazione, the theatrical production of "The Dover Road", and the second Annual Faculty Banquet. The Macdonald Institute column provides comments on the Homemaker Banquet and the Senior Party. While the Alumni column contains alumni updates.
